# Tollgate Consent Banner — Environments

The Tollgate consent banner rolls out across three environments: sandbox, preview, and production. Sandbox disables consent persistence entirely; preview stores choices in Varnholt-region storage only; production enforces regional residency. Reviewers should confirm that logging excludes pre-consent identifiers. Each environment's enforced configuration appears below.

config for hawep-taweg:
[frair]
port = 8443
region = west-3
host = frair.sivrelhq.internal
team = oliael
timeout_ms = 1000
retries = 2

Release checklist — Grelltide barcode scanner integration. Reviewer must confirm: the Pikelock SDK shim handles malformed GS1 payloads without crashing the intake worker; duplicate-scan debounce is set to 400ms; and the fallback manual-entry path logs the same event schema as hardware scans. Verify the contract tests against the Dunmore warehouse simulator all pass in the merge pipeline. The passing pipeline run is identified by the token below.

build token for hafop-fawif: htk31_9758d5e565aa3b14f55d629377373c4

Handover: Glimwork component library. We follow strict semver; breaking prop changes bump major, new components bump minor. Never publish from a laptop — CI only. Deprecations live two majors before removal. Release notes go in `CHANGES.md`. The publish credentials vault on the Norbeck runner opens with the recovery passphrase below.

recovery phrase for fajep-yaweg: gilath-sorox-wenius-rusdor-keliel-zorius

# Insurance Renewal — Restricted (Managers Only)

The Brellick Mutual policy renews next quarter. Premium increase: 9%, driven by the warehouse claim at the Dunmore site. Coverage limits unchanged; cyber rider added at modest cost. Finance should budget accordingly and flag any objections within two weeks. Broker comparison showed no better terms. Context on why we are accepting the increase follows.

board note of fahif-yahog: Gross margin on Wenath came in at 10 percent against a plan of 5 percent. Only 3 of the 100 pilot accounts renewed Wenath, so a churn review is set for July 15.